Ronald Epstein
Stock Analyst at B of A Securities
(3.81)
# 596
Out of 4,827 analysts
252
Total ratings
58.75%
Success rate
3.52%
Average return
Main Sectors:
Stocks Rated by Ronald Epstein
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
PSN Parsons | Maintains: Buy | $130 → $110 | $62.38 | +76.34% | 5 | Apr 1, 2025 | |
BWXT BWX Technologies | Maintains: Buy | $160 → $135 | $106.99 | +26.18% | 12 | Mar 26, 2025 | |
AIN Albany International | Maintains: Underperform | $80 → $75 | $63.75 | +17.65% | 5 | Mar 25, 2025 | |
LMT Lockheed Martin | Downgrades: Neutral | $685 → $485 | $467.00 | +3.85% | 8 | Mar 24, 2025 | |
TDY Teledyne Technologies | Maintains: Buy | $550 → $600 | $479.45 | +25.14% | 8 | Mar 17, 2025 | |
AER AerCap Holdings | Maintains: Buy | $105 → $125 | $107.94 | +15.81% | 5 | Mar 7, 2025 | |
AL Air Lease | Downgrades: Underperform | $72 → $50 | $52.28 | -4.36% | 5 | Mar 7, 2025 | |
DRS Leonardo DRS | Upgrades: Buy | $40 | $41.62 | -3.89% | 4 | Mar 7, 2025 | |
LUNR Intuitive Machines | Initiates: Underperform | $16 | $8.83 | +81.20% | 1 | Feb 5, 2025 | |
LHX L3Harris Technologies | Maintains: Buy | $300 → $265 | $216.31 | +22.51% | 5 | Feb 4,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$145 → $155 | $128.24 | +20.87% | 7 | Jan 30,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$200 → $225 | $209.45 | +7.42% | 3 | Jan 27,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$110 → $85 | $69.96 | +21.50% | 18 | Jan 24, 2025 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$34 → $32 | $27.26 | +17.41% | 2 | Nov 27,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$40 → $55 | $46.53 | +18.20% | 9 | Nov 21,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Neutral | $330 → $335 | $340.00 | -1.47% | 2 | Nov 21,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$10 → $30 | $22.16 | +35.38% | 2 | Nov 14,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$100 → $135 | $156.44 | -13.70% | 4 | Nov 13,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Underperform | $250 → $195 | $233.22 | -16.39% | 10 | Nov 13,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$17 → $12 | $25.50 | -52.93% | 12 | Sep 24,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$250 → $285 | $262.14 | +8.72% | 9 | Sep 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$250 → $285 | $209.94 | +35.75% | 9 | Sep 19,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$200 | $185.50 | +7.82% | 18 | Jun 18,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$1,310 → $1,460 | $1,391.00 | +4.96% | 15 | May 29,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$140 → $165 | $165.95 | -0.57% | 4 | May 29,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$165 → $150 | $187.01 | -19.79% | 12 | May 22,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$75 → $65 | $50.65 | +28.33% | 8 | Apr 10,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reinstates: Underperform | $30 | $50.33 | -40.39% | 8 | Nov 29,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Upgrades: Buy | $110 → $130 | $123.50 | +5.26% | 12 | Oct 3,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Underperform | $18 → $22 | $35.69 | -38.36% | 14 | Aug 25,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$365 → $385 | $472.49 | -18.52% | 2 | Aug 17,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$33 → $37 | $25.44 | +45.44% | 3 | Aug 15,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$655 → $615 | $488.16 | +25.98% | 1 | Jul 28,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$35 → $29 | $30.21 | -4.01% | 2 | Mar 30,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Underperform | $140 → $100 | $2.83 | +3,433.57% | 4 | Aug 18,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Underperform | $40 → $14 | $9.40 | +48.94% | 2 | Jan 19,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$120 → $125 | $154.61 | -19.15% | 1 | Mar 3, 2021 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$245 → $260 | $270.67 | -3.94% | 1 | Jan 25, 2018 |
Parsons
Apr 1, 2025
Maintains: Buy
Price Target: $130 → $110
Current: $62.38
Upside: +76.34%
BWX Technologies
Mar 26, 2025
Maintains: Buy
Price Target: $160 → $135
Current: $106.99
Upside: +26.18%
Albany International
Mar 25, 2025
Maintains: Underperform
Price Target: $80 → $75
Current: $63.75
Upside: +17.65%
Lockheed Martin
Mar 24, 2025
Downgrades: Neutral
Price Target: $685 → $485
Current: $467.00
Upside: +3.85%
Teledyne Technologies
Mar 17, 2025
Maintains: Buy
Price Target: $550 → $600
Current: $479.45
Upside: +25.14%
AerCap Holdings
Mar 7, 2025
Maintains: Buy
Price Target: $105 → $125
Current: $107.94
Upside: +15.81%
Air Lease
Mar 7, 2025
Downgrades: Underperform
Price Target: $72 → $50
Current: $52.28
Upside: -4.36%
Leonardo DRS
Mar 7, 2025
Upgrades: Buy
Price Target: $40
Current: $41.62
Upside: -3.89%
Intuitive Machines
Feb 5, 2025
Initiates: Underperform
Price Target: $16
Current: $8.83
Upside: +81.20%
L3Harris Technologies
Feb 4, 2025
Maintains: Buy
Price Target: $300 → $265
Current: $216.31
Upside: +22.51%
Jan 30, 2025
Maintains: Buy
Price Target: $145 → $155
Current: $128.24
Upside: +20.87%
Jan 27, 2025
Maintains: Buy
Price Target: $200 → $225
Current: $209.45
Upside: +7.42%
Jan 24, 2025
Downgrades: Neutral
Price Target: $110 → $85
Current: $69.96
Upside: +21.50%
Nov 27, 2024
Maintains: Neutral
Price Target: $34 → $32
Current: $27.26
Upside: +17.41%
Nov 21, 2024
Maintains: Buy
Price Target: $40 → $55
Current: $46.53
Upside: +18.20%
Nov 21, 2024
Downgrades: Neutral
Price Target: $330 → $335
Current: $340.00
Upside: -1.47%
Nov 14, 2024
Maintains: Buy
Price Target: $10 → $30
Current: $22.16
Upside: +35.38%
Nov 13, 2024
Maintains: Buy
Price Target: $100 → $135
Current: $156.44
Upside: -13.70%
Nov 13, 2024
Maintains: Underperform
Price Target: $250 → $195
Current: $233.22
Upside: -16.39%
Sep 24, 2024
Downgrades: Underperform
Price Target: $17 → $12
Current: $25.50
Upside: -52.93%
Sep 19, 2024
Maintains: Buy
Price Target: $250 → $285
Current: $262.14
Upside: +8.72%
Sep 19, 2024
Maintains: Buy
Price Target: $250 → $285
Current: $209.94
Upside: +35.75%
Jun 18, 2024
Maintains: Neutral
Price Target: $200
Current: $185.50
Upside: +7.82%
May 29, 2024
Maintains: Buy
Price Target: $1,310 → $1,460
Current: $1,391.00
Upside: +4.96%
May 29, 2024
Maintains: Buy
Price Target: $140 → $165
Current: $165.95
Upside: -0.57%
May 22, 2024
Downgrades: Underperform
Price Target: $165 → $150
Current: $187.01
Upside: -19.79%
Apr 10, 2024
Downgrades: Underperform
Price Target: $75 → $65
Current: $50.65
Upside: +28.33%
Nov 29, 2023
Reinstates: Underperform
Price Target: $30
Current: $50.33
Upside: -40.39%
Oct 3, 2023
Upgrades: Buy
Price Target: $110 → $130
Current: $123.50
Upside: +5.26%
Aug 25, 2023
Maintains: Underperform
Price Target: $18 → $22
Current: $35.69
Upside: -38.36%
Aug 17, 2023
Maintains: Buy
Price Target: $365 → $385
Current: $472.49
Upside: -18.52%
Aug 15, 2023
Maintains: Neutral
Price Target: $33 → $37
Current: $25.44
Upside: +45.44%
Jul 28, 2023
Maintains: Buy
Price Target: $655 → $615
Current: $488.16
Upside: +25.98%
Mar 30, 2023
Maintains: Buy
Price Target: $35 → $29
Current: $30.21
Upside: -4.01%
Aug 18, 2022
Maintains: Underperform
Price Target: $140 → $100
Current: $2.83
Upside: +3,433.57%
Jan 19, 2022
Downgrades: Underperform
Price Target: $40 → $14
Current: $9.40
Upside: +48.94%
Mar 3, 2021
Maintains: Buy
Price Target: $120 → $125
Current: $154.61
Upside: -19.15%
Jan 25, 2018
Maintains: Buy
Price Target: $245 → $260
Current: $270.67
Upside: -3.94%